The Cornhill beat of the River Carron will be let on the following terms and conditions: Cornhill consists of 12 named pools fished from the left bank only, the top extent of the fishings being the head of The Clump and the lower extend of the fishings being The Middle of the Whirl pool. Dounie and Gledfield are opposite and will be fishing the other bank. Rods are requested to adhere to the normal etiquette of salmon fishing, and are reminded to keep moving down a pool, not to enter a pool below another angler, and to avoid deep wading. There is a specific rule applying to the 5 pools shared between Dounie and Cornhill (Clump - Wall Pool inclusive). If 2 rods are fishing these five pools from the same bank, they are not to fish consecutive pools at the same time. This allows a rod from the other bank to fish the pool in between. The maximum number of rods allowed at any one time will be 2. There will be no rod sharing without prior approval. There is no resident ghillie although Alan Donaldson, part time ghillie, may be available (tel.no. 01863 755311). He is also a flytier and can provide local patterns. Fishing will be by rod and line and fly only, and there will be no exception to this rule. A record of numbers and weights of all fish caught together with a record of pools and angler’s name must be kept and entered in the weekly returns form provided. The completed return form must be returned to this office the week following a let. Please note the conservation guidelines contained in the attached “Salmon Conservation Policy River Carron 2006”. All fish caught will remain the property of the tenant, subject to the bag limits in force from time to time. All those fishing must have treated their fishing tackle and equipment against the Gyrodactylus salaris parasite in accordance with Scottish Office recommendations. The fishing tenant must also have signed and returned the certificate prior to any fishing taking place. There are two huts on the beat and a car park at the top hut.
